About Bottle Rocket Pattaya
Bottle-shop-and-bar concept on Pratumnak. Suits casual drinkers after retail-priced wines opened on the spot.

Frequently asked questions
What time does Bottle Rocket Pattaya get busy?
Most evenings the venue fills up around 9pm-10pm and stays busy until close. Friday and Saturday are noticeably busier than midweek. Arriving early gives you the better seats and a cheaper happy-hour drink before the crowd builds.
What hours is Bottle Rocket Pattaya open?
Listed hours are 17:00-00:00 daily. Closing time is usually enforced by local licensing. After-hours options exist nearby ask staff for current recommendations.
